Can I stop taking Cepown CV when I feel better?

1:15

Can I stop taking Cepown CV when I feel better?

It is crucial not to cease the intake of Cepown CV prematurely and adhere to the full duration of the prescribed treatment regardless of any potential improvement in symptoms Even if you start feeling better it does not necessarily mean that the infection has been completely eradicated By discontinuing the medication prematurely you risk the likelihood of the infection relapsing and becoming more resilient to future treatments It is essential to understand that antibiotics work by targeting and eliminating the infectioncausing bacteria gradually which is why it is imperative to complete the entire course as advised by your healthcare professional Doing so ensures that all the bacteria are effectively eradicated reducing the risk of recurrence and the development of antibioticresistant strains Therefore even if you experience relief from your symptoms it is crucial to continue taking Cepown CV until the prescribed course is completed to ensure a complete and successful recovery Remember following the instructions of your healthcare provider is paramount in effectively treating your infection and safeguarding your health

Is Nvset a steroid?

1:15

Is Nvset a steroid?

No Nvset is not a steroid but rather an antiemetic medication Specifically Nvset functions as a selective 5HT3 receptor antagonist Its primary purpose is to prevent and alleviate the symptoms of nausea and vomiting This medication is commonly prescribed for individuals who experience these discomforts following surgical procedures or as a result of cancer chemotherapy By targeting the 5HT3 receptors Nvset helps to inhibit the signals responsible for triggering nausea and vomiting providing relief to patients in need It is important to note that while Nvset effectively addresses these symptoms it does not possess any steroid properties Therefore individuals seeking a steroidbased medication for their concerns should consult with their healthcare provider for alternative options
